To be eligible for admission to the BEng in Electrical Engineering program, prospective students must meet specific academic requirements. A minimum of 60% in high school courses such as English, Mathematics, Physics, and Chemistry is necessary, along with a minimum of 70% in Mathematics 30-1. If these criteria are not met, students may be considered for conditional admission, requiring them to complete additional courses to fulfill the program's prerequisites.

In terms of tuition, international students can expect to pay approximately CAD 38,826 annually.
